Ensure the fuel tank is filled and the oil level is adequate. Prime the engine by pressing the primer bulb three times, pull the starter rope firmly to start the engine.
Use unleaded gasoline with a minimum of 87 octane. Avoid using ethanol blends higher than 10%.
Sharpen the blades at least once per mowing season or when you notice the grass is being torn rather than cut cleanly.
Check the fuel level, inspect the spark plug for fouling, and ensure the air filter is clean. Replace any damaged components.
Disconnect the spark plug for safety, tilt the mower to its side, and use a hose to wash off grass clippings and debris from the deck.
Perform regular maintenance every 25 hours of operation, including oil changes, air filter cleaning, and blade sharpening.
Warm up the engine, turn off and disconnect the spark plug, remove the oil cap, and drain the old oil into a container. Refill with new oil as per the specifications.
Check for debris stuck in the blades or under the deck, ensure the blade is balanced and properly installed, and inspect the mower for any loose parts.
Locate the air filter cover, remove it, take out the old air filter, and replace it with a new one. Ensure the cover is securely reattached.
Clean the mower thoroughly, empty the fuel tank, change the oil, and store it in a dry, sheltered location. Disconnect the spark plug to prevent accidental starts.
